#35a713 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#35a713 is composed of 20.8% red, 65.5%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.6%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 106.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 36.5%. #35a713 color hex could be obtained by blending #6aff26 with #004f00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#35a713

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030801 is the darkest color, while #f8f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#35a713

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5f5b is the less saturated color, while #2db505 is the most saturated one.
